Five-star 2020 Norcross, Georgia prospect and No. 1-rated offensive tackle
Myles Hinton included Clemson in his top-5 schools list on Monday.
Hinton has Clemson in a group with Michigan, Georgia, Northwestern and Stanford. He is the brother of 2019 five-star DE Chris Hinton, who committed to Michigan last August and the Wolverines have been regarded as a leader for the younger Hinton. Their father, Chris, was a seven-time Pro Bowl selection as an offensive lineman over 13 seasons with the Colts, Atlanta Falcons and Minnesota Vikings, after playing college ball at Northwestern. Myles hasn't reported an offer from Clemson at this point. Clemson cornerback signee Kyler McMichael also played at Greater Atlanta Christian. Top Five pic.twitter.com/xbl7JoykhD
